Ce'Cile isn't just a singer; she's a cultural force, a sonic architect who sculpted her own space within the reggae and dancehall landscape. Emerging from Kingston, Jamaica, she's defied expectations, delivering raw, unapologetic lyrics with a vocal prowess that's both commanding and seductive. Her sound, a potent blend of reggae's rhythmic foundation, dancehall's infectious energy, and a subtle infusion of R&B and pop sensibilities, has cemented her place as a genre-bending innovator. Ce'Cile’s career trajectory took off in the early 2000s, fueled by hits like "Changez" and collaborations with artists like Sean Paul ("Can You Do the Work") and Shaggy. These tracks weren't just club bangers; they were statements of female empowerment, laced with humor and honesty. She didn't shy away from controversial topics, tackling sexuality and societal norms head-on, making her a voice for a generation. Beyond the radio hits, Ce'Cile’s enduring impact lies in her willingness to experiment and push boundaries. Her discography showcases a versatility that sets her apart, demonstrating an ability to deliver hard-hitting anthems and introspective ballads with equal conviction. Always evolving, Ce'Cile continues to release new music and tour globally, remaining a vital and relevant figure in the ever-changing world of reggae and dancehall.
